📄 c程序.txt
字号:
/*------------------------------------------------------------------------------- wrcommand_sed1335()向SED1335LCM写入一个指令--------------------------------------------------------------------------------*/ void wrcommand_sed1335(uchar command) { //片选 CS_SED1335=0; // rdsta_sed1335(); //读状态,等空闲 // A0_SED1335=1; DATA_BUS=command; delay_io(); WR_SED1335=0; delay_io(); WR_SED1335=1; //非片选 CS_SED1335=1; }/*------------------------------------------------------------------------------- wrdata_sed1335(uchar datax)向SED1335LCM写入一个数据--------------------------------------------------------------------------------*/ void wrdata_sed1335(uchar datax) { //片选 CS_SED1335=0; // rdsta_sed1335(); //读状态,等空闲 // A0_SED1335=0; DATA_BUS=datax; delay_io(); WR_SED1335=0; delay_io(); WR_SED1335=1; //非片选 CS_SED1335=1; }/*------------------------------------------------------------------------------- SYSTEMSET_SED1335()LCM系统设置--------------------------------------------------------------------------------*/ void SYSTEMSET_SED1335() { TR0=0; ET0=0; ES0=0; // wrcommand_sed1335(0x40); //命令40H参数设置,#0101H为命令口地址 //p1 写 wrdata_sed1335(0x30); //0x30 ok //p2 wrdata_sed1335(0x87); //0x87 设置光标宽度为8 //p3 wrdata_sed1335(0x87); //0x07 ok //p4 写C/R wrdata_sed1335(40); //0x27,设置LCD每行需要的字节数,每行320个点,行数为320/8-1=39 //p5 写TC/R wrdata_sed1335(70); //0x42,设置液晶的扫描频率约为70HZ //p6 写L/F wrdata_sed1335(240); //0xf0,设置LCD的行数为239 //p7 写APL wrdata_sed1335(40); //0x28 //p8 写APH wrdata_sed1335(0x00); //0x00 //非片选 CS_SED1335=1; TR0=1; ET0=0; ES0=1; }
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-